“He’s our general”: Jamal Murray rebounds as Nuggets seize control of first-round series

192
0

SAN ANTONIO — About 20 minutes after the Nuggets had seized control of the first-round series against the Spurs, Jamal Murray stood out the interview room Saturday spinning a basketball on his finger and pitching bounce passes off the wall in the corridors of the AT&T Center.

Evidently, he hadn’t feasted enough throughout the Nuggets’ rollicking second-half surge in Game 4.

Murray was paramount to their win — Denver’s first in San Antonio since 2012 — and any possibility the Nuggets had in wresting control of the series laid in the hands of the third-year point guard.

With momentum teetering in the third quarter and the Nuggets up 71-69, Murray’s 3-pointer and ferocious dunk stretched the lead to 76-69. The energy changed, and the margin never got closer than five points the rest of the game.

“It happened so quickly,” said Murray, who finished with 24 points and six assists. “I remember the sequence, but I was like … I didn’t understand the dunk. I haven’t seen it. ”

Murray’s backdoor dunk was the crescendo of a 37-point quarter, which saw Denver’s three most valuable players deflate any hope of a Spurs victory and change the trajectory of the series. Nikola Jokic scored 11 of his game-high 29 points in the period, and Torrey Craig, starting in place of Will Barton, drilled two of his five 3-pointers. The Nuggets hit 15 3-pointers as a team, which countered their 37 percent shooting in the first half.

“(Jamal) wants such a tiny trigger to step on another level, and when he steps on another level, he brings us with him,” Jokic said. “He’s our point guard, he’s our leader on the ground, he’s our general, so we follow him when he has energy that is great. ”

Murray’s defense drew the brunt of criticism after Spurs point guard Derrick White went off for a career-high 36 points in Game 3. Multiple players said they took his match — and the way the Spurs had imposed their will on the Nuggets — personally. Because of this, Nuggets coach Michael Malone switched up rsquo & his team;s assignments. Murray drew Spurs guard Bryn Forbes, while Gary Harris took White. It was Craig who had been left to nag DeMar DeRozan.

White managed just eight points while committing four turnovers. DeRozan was flustered into an ejection and 19 points. Forbes scored an inconsequential 10 points.

“I believed (Jamal) was a lot more engaged, I thought he played a lot tougher, played a lot more urgency,” Nuggets coach Michael Malone said. “I’m not surprised because most of us know what Derrick White did last match. ”

Denver’s win is a step for this group, most of whom are taking in the postseason for the first time. Consider what they learned in steamy San Antonio. Their defense got exposed in Game 3; they had their toughness they had been taught the difference between regular- season and postseason fouls; and they weathered another first quarter in Game 4 to steal home-court advantage right back.

As the Nuggets exhaled on the plane back to Denver, not only could they rest easy with the knowledge that two wins at Pepsi Center means they’ll advance to the second round, they could take solace in the fact that this group has now won on the road in the postseason. That knowledge will pay dividends as far as they go in and this season — future runs.

“I just feel like we’ve seen it at a young age so far,” Murray said. “Going to the playoffs is a significant experience for us, and we’re learning on the fly. ”
